Source: Tourism MediaPortland Head LightVerdenNordamerikaUSACumberland CountyMainePortlandPortland Head Light
Source: Tourism MediaPortland Head LightVerdenNordamerikaUSACumberland CountyMainePortlandPortland Head Light
Source: Tourism MediaPortland Head LightVerdenNordamerikaUSACumberland CountyMainePortlandPortland Head Light
Source: Tourism MediaPortland Head LightVerdenNordamerikaUSACumberland CountyMainePortlandPortland Head Light
Source: Tourism MediaSpring Point Ledge LightVerdenNordamerikaUSACumberland CountyMaineSpring Point Ledge Light
Source: Tourism MediaHiggins BeachVerdenNordamerikaUSACumberland CountyMainePortlandScarboroughHiggins Beach
Source: Tourism MediaSpring Point Ledge LightVerdenNordamerikaUSACumberland CountyMaineSpring Point Ledge Light
Source: Tourism MediaPortland Head LightVerdenNordamerikaUSACumberland CountyMainePortlandPortland Head Light
Source: Tourism MediaPortland Head LightVerdenNordamerikaUSACumberland CountyMainePortlandPortland Head Light
Source: Tourism MediaPortland Head LightVerdenNordamerikaUSACumberland CountyMainePortlandPortland Head Light
Source: Tourism MediaHiggins BeachVerdenNordamerikaUSACumberland CountyMainePortlandScarboroughHiggins Beach
Source: Tourism MediaBracy CoveVerdenNordamerikaUSAHancock CountyMaineBar HarborSeal HarborBracy Cove
Source: Tourism MediaSpring Point Ledge LightVerdenNordamerikaUSACumberland CountyMaineSpring Point Ledge Light
Source: Tourism MediaPortland Head LightVerdenNordamerikaUSACumberland CountyMainePortlandPortland Head Light
Source: Tourism MediaSpring Point Ledge LightVerdenNordamerikaUSACumberland CountyMaineSpring Point Ledge Light
Source: Tourism MediaLong Sands BeachVerdenNordamerikaUSAYork CountyMaineOgunquit - WellsLong Sands Beach
Source: Tourism MediaLong Sands BeachVerdenNordamerikaUSAYork CountyMaineOgunquit - WellsLong Sands Beach
Source: Tourism MediaPortland Head LightVerdenNordamerikaUSACumberland CountyMainePortlandPortland Head Light